the Ol'Buz...the advantage of a small community.<br />the Ol'BuzzardOl'Buzzardhttps://www.blogger.com/profile/00075162476463971258noreply@blogger.comtag:blogger.com,1999:blog-8689245642139665514.post-18317189407742978492016-08-12T17:32:04.811-06:002016-08-12T17:32:04.811-06:00Carry on...Carry on...BBChttps://www.blogger.com/profile/15323188240580782454noreply@blogger.comtag:blogger.com,1999:blog-8689245642139665514.post-57371591645842071702016-08-12T04:10:59.507-06:002016-08-12T04:10:59.507-06:00Sausage (kolbasa in Russian, kovbasa in Ukrainian,...Sausage (kolbasa in Russian, kovbasa in Ukrainian, kielbasa in Polish) is mainly eaten cold here. It is coarsely ground, spiced and smoked. It comes in mainly in chubs of varying diameters and lengths. I like the brand of ring sausage the local supermarket carries. Some of the chubs are really dry and fermented (like pepperoni). those are Tanya's favourites.
